I will say the problem is more general.
The error is displayed anytime you try to auto-complete when you are at
the beginning of the line in the history.
For example: (provided you have history)
Press UP, press HOME, press TAB.
DistroRelease: Ubuntu 10.04
Package: bash-completion 1:1.1-3ubuntu2
I also get:
$ bash: $COMP_POINT: substring expression < 0
bash: $COMP_POINT: substring expression < 0
bash: COMP_WORDS: bad array subscript
